    The camera is compatible with Windows XP. Here's the link with system requirements:

    http://www.microsoft.com/hardware/d...ls.aspx?pid=014&active_tab=systemRequirements

    Assuming it came with a driver disk, try these steps:

    Unplug the camera, then uninstall the camera software and uninstall the drivers from the Device Manager.

    Restart the computer.

    Follow the instructions (some hardware wants you to install the CD first before plugging it in, others want you to plug it in first before installing the CD).

    Also, when you do reconnect the camera, try a different USB port.
